Port configuration consists of two C type PD ports and three USB A ports.

A port supports Quick Charge 3.0. C type PD port can see 100W output.

A port output test. Pokopone Quick Charge 3.0, S10 plus AFC (Quick Charge 2.0) output is very good.

There is no picture, but iPhone or iPad 5V 2.4A = 12W output is also good!

C type PD port test.

I tested Pokopone and S10 Plus first. Charging works very well without any problems.

Gram PD charge test.

At first, it will be full charged to 52W at the time of single output. Here you can charge even if you connect 45W auxiliary battery!

It is very good !! There are a lot of products with two PD ports, but the high power at the same time in two ports

It's hard to find, but this charger is available.

There is no picture, but two simultaneous charging of the PD auxiliary battery was possible

(Xiaomi + QB820)

We used two A ports as quick charge while using two PD ports at the same time.

Charging is good. I was a bit scared from here. Now I get 120W with simple output.

So I tried one more connection.

I was afraid that I could not connect the Quick Charger and connected the iPad Mini 5.

I will charge the first time Oh ... 5 simultaneous use? At one moment

Yes ... One A port is powered on. It looks like the safety device is working. So when one of the ports dies

Do not panic, remove the charger power cord altogether, wait a minute and then plug it back in.

Normal operation.

I have tried various tests since then, but one A port is dead.
